Psycho Peacock sextuples capacity with double Durst buy

Wide-format events and exhibitions printer Psycho Peacock has taken delivery of two brand-new 3.5m Durst roll-to-roll print engines, effectively increasing its capacity by up to six times.

Konica Minolta streamlines business units

Konica Minolta is streamlining its business units into three – a move that means Professional Print will be combined with its workplace operations in a huge new division.

End of the line for Greenshires

Greenshires Group has gone into administration, with all employees laid off.

CoverUp up to date with 5m EFI install

Dublin-based wide-format trade printer CoverUp has brought its super-wide mesh printing operation up-to-date with a refurbished EFI Matan 5m roll-to-roll engine.

Sprintprint upgrades Konica Minolta workhorse

Sprintprint has swapped out one of its two Konica Minolta AccurioPress toner engines for a brand-new AccurioPress C4070 with air-feed deck.

Inkcups to debut Helix One updates at Fespa

Inkcups is set to debut updates to its Helix One benchtop direct-to-object cylinder printer at Fespa’s Global Print Expo in Amsterdam next month.

Fujifilm flags wide-ranging price rises in Europe

Fujifilm has announced “double digit” price increases on a range of products that will come into effect next month.
